Jenin refugee camp.

 According to the Israeli government, it was necessary to invade the Jenin refugee camp on Monday, in order to stop the possibility of terrorist attacks. This was the biggest intervention for over 20 years - into the West Bank. Many homes in the area have no water or electricity - in addition homes have been destroyed. Some 12 Palestinian people have died, but more are expected. There is little faith in the Palestinian Authority (PA) as many of the young think they have sold out.
